How to effectively engage secondary students in your Maths classroom September 2022
Students learn best when they are motivated to learn by seeing the value and importance of the information presented. This presentation will exhibit our STAR Methodology, which Adam Kruger and Scott Rumble have co- developed and implemented at a number of schools. Throughout the session they will demonstrate how we motivate students to learning, create an interactive atmosphere to allow for student voice, build connections through directed assessments, provide opportunities to apply knowledge to real world situations, challenge and engage students through effective feedback strategies and work through using data as a tool to improve key numeracy skills of our students. In this workshop you will:
- Walk away with insightful data analysis skills,
- Be given a bank of engaging activities,
- Learn strategies that you can use immediately in your classroom.
